Our first penalty report of the season reveals that 16 Redskins have been flagged for enforced penalties. The leaders:
Trent Williams: 4 penalties-40 yards (two holdings, one false start, one unnecessary roughness).
Jammal Brown: 4-30 (two false starts, one holding, one illegal use of hands).
Rex Grossman: 4-26 (three delay of games, one intentional grounding).
Rob Jackson: 3-26 (one illegal block above the waist and one off-sides on kickoff coverage on special teams, one roughing the quarterback on defense).
